Eagle Rock Elementary School is a public Elementary school located in Eagle Point, OREGON, operated by the Eagle Point SD 9 school district. It serves grades KG–05.

Key statistics: 288 students enrolled; a 17.5:1 student-to-teacher ratio.

The school is classified as Suburb: Midsize by the NCES locale classification system.

Data sourced from the National Center for Education Statistics (NCES) Common Core of Data (CCD), the definitive federal database of U.S. public schools, updated annually.
